Boiled Deer Ardennes Recipe
Yield: 1 ServingsRecipe by luhu.jp
Ingredients:
2 lbs: Deer, lean
4 tbsp: Flour,
1 cup: Brown vinegar,
1 cup: Water, cold
1: Onion, small, chop fine
1/4 tsp: Cloves, ground
1/2 tsp: Ginger, ground
1/2 tsp: Salt,
1/8 tsp: Pepper, black
Directions:
Cut deer into bite-size pieces. Boil chunks of deer in water seasoned
well with salt and pepper. Remove and drain well. While boiling deer,
make a gravy: Mix 4 Tbsp flour with cold water to make a thin paste.
Place in saucepan or frying pan. Add all other ingredients, stirring
well over medium heat until a smooth gravy is formed. Pour gravy over
deer chunks immediately before serving. Time it and take great care
that all is piping hot.
VARIATION: Boil deer in seasoned broth by adding a small amount of any
popular marinade or herb/seafood seasoning.
